The principal reason to travel to North Sydney is to take the Newfoundland ferry. As such, there are not really any attractions in the town. For travellers passing through, there are a few accommodations, restaurants and fast food outlets that offer good quality. Access to the Trans-Canada Highway is easy and quick.
